
web个人网站设计源代码 web个人网站设计源代码是什么 ,对于想了解建站百科知识的朋友们来说,web个人网站设计源代码 web个人网站设计源代码是什么是一个非常想了解的问题,下面小编就带领大家看看这个问题。
在数字浪潮席卷全球的今天,拥有一个独特的个人网站,已成为展示自我、连接世界的前沿阵地。而构筑这个数字空间的基石,正是Web个人网站设计源代码。它绝非冰冷枯燥的字符堆砌,而是一套蕴含逻辑、美学与个性的数字化蓝图,是开发者思想与创意的直接转译。本文旨在揭开这层神秘面纱,深入探讨其核心内涵、关键构成与设计精髓,助你不仅理解其“形”,更能掌握其“魂”,打造出既符合技术规范,又闪耀个人色彩的线上家园。

Web个人网站设计源代码,本质上是一系列遵循特定语法规则的文本指令集合。它如同建筑师的施工图纸,详细规定了网站这座“数字建筑”的每一个细节:从宏观的结构布局(HTML),到视觉的外观装饰(CSS),再到动态的交互行为(JavaScript)。这三者构成了前端源代码的“三驾马车”,共同决定了用户在浏览器中所见所感的一切。

理解源代码,就是理解网站的运行逻辑。当你在浏览器地址栏输入网址,服务器便将这份“蓝图”发送至你的电脑。浏览器则扮演了“施工队”的角色,忠实地逐行解读这些代码,将其渲染成可视化的网页。源代码的质量直接决定了网站的加载速度、兼容性、可访问性以及最终的用户体验。清晰、简洁、语义化的代码,是构建高效、稳健网站的基石。
更进一步说,源代码是开放网络精神的体现。通过浏览器的“查看网页源代码”功能,任何人都可以学习、借鉴他人的设计思路。这种开放性极大地推动了Web技术的普及与创新,使得个人网站建设不再是少数专家的专利,而成为每个有想法的人触手可及的创造工具。
`, ``)来组织信息,赋予内容以语义和层级。良好的HTML结构不仅利于浏览器解析,更是搜索引擎理解网页内容、进行排名索引(SEO)的关键。
如果说HTML构建了毛坯房,那么CSS(层叠样式表)就是负责精装修的设计师。CSS源代码控制着网站的所有视觉表现:颜色、字体、间距、布局、动画效果等。通过将样式与内容分离,CSS使得网站改版变得轻而易举,只需修改样式文件,即可让整个网站焕然一新。响应式设计的实现也依赖于CSS媒体查询等技术,确保网站在从手机到桌面的各种设备上都能完美呈现。
而JavaScript则为这座静态建筑注入了灵魂与活力。它是一门脚本编程语言,通过源代码实现页面的动态交互功能。例如,表单验证、图片轮播、内容动态加载、与用户的实时反馈等,都离不开JavaScript。现代前端框架(如Vue.js, React)更是基于JavaScript,帮助开发者高效构建复杂的单页面应用,极大地丰富了个人网站的功能与用户体验。

优秀的源代码设计,始于对用户体验的深刻洞察。代码的编写不应只追求功能的实现,更需考虑性能优化。这包括压缩文件大小、减少HTTP请求、使用高效的算法等,以确保网站快速加载,避免用户因等待而流失。速度本身就是用户体验和SEO排名的重要因素。
可维护性与可扩展性是另一项核心原则。随着网站内容的增长和功能的添加,清晰、模块化的代码结构显得至关重要。采用合理的注释、遵循一致的命名规范、将代码按功能模块组织,能使日后修改变得轻松,也便于与他人协作。这要求开发者在编写之初就具备长远眼光。
跨浏览器兼容性与可访问性(Accessibility)必须被纳入源代码设计考量。你的网站需要在不同内核的浏览器中表现一致,并且要考虑到残障人士(如视障用户)的访问需求,例如为图片添加替代文本、保证足够的色彩对比度等。这不仅体现了技术包容性,也符合现代Web标准与。
是网站性能的代码级优化。搜索引擎青睐加载迅速的网站。通过优化图片(压缩、使用WebP格式)、启用浏览器缓存、最小化CSS/JavaScript文件、使用异步或延迟加载非关键资源等技术手段,可以有效提升页面速度评分,这在百度等搜索引擎的排名算法中权重日益增加。
是构建清晰的网站内部链接结构与URL语义化。合理的导航链接和面包屑路径,不仅方便用户浏览,也便于搜索引擎蜘蛛爬取和索引全站内容。简洁、包含关键词的URL(如`/projects/web-design`)比充满参数的动态URL更受搜索引擎欢迎。
个人网站同样面临安全威胁,而安全的防线需从源代码层面筑起。最常见的问题是防范跨站脚本攻击(XSS)。这要求在处理用户输入(如评论、表单)时,必须对输入内容进行严格的过滤、转义或验证,防止恶意脚本被注入到页面中执行。
需确保通信安全。即便是个人网站,也应尽可能使用HTTPS协议。这需要配置SSL/TLS证书,并在源代码中确保所有资源链接(如图片、样式表)都使用相对路径或`https://`绝对路径,避免出现“混合内容”警告,保护用户数据在传输过程中的安全。
对于涉及后台或数据库的网站,更要警惕SQL注入等攻击。应采用参数化查询或使用成熟的ORM框架,避免将用户输入直接拼接成SQL语句。定期更新所使用的开发框架、库和CMS核心,修补已知漏洞,是维护网站长期安全的基础工作。
Web技术日新月异,个人网站设计的源代码也在不断演进。静态网站生成器的复兴(如Hugo, Jekyll, Hexo)是一个显著趋势。它们允许开发者用Markdown书写内容,再通过模板和源代码生成纯静态的HTML网站,兼具了动态网站的易维护性和静态网站的高性能与高安全性,非常适合博客、作品集类个人网站。
组件化与模块化开发思想已深入人心。借助Web Components标准或React/Vue等框架,开发者可以将UI界面拆分为独立、可复用的组件。每个组件拥有自己的HTML、CSS、JavaScript代码,使得大型项目的源代码结构更清晰,开发效率更高,维护成本更低。
展望未来,WebAssembly等新技术将允许用C++、Rust等语言编写高性能代码并在浏览器中运行,为个人网站带来接近原生的复杂应用体验。人工智能辅助编程工具的出现,可能会改变源代码的编写方式,但开发者对架构设计、逻辑思维和审美判断的核心作用将愈发重要。
Web个人网站设计源代码远不止是技术实现的工具,它是个人在数字世界宣示主权、塑造身份的创造性媒介。从定义结构的HTML,到赋予美感的CSS,再到驱动交互的JavaScript,每一行代码都凝结着创造者的思考与意图。卓越的源代码,必然是性能、可维护性、安全性与SEO友好的完美结合体。
在开源与共享的互联网精神下,学习、阅读并编写这些源代码,是一个不断将抽象想法转化为具体现实的过程。它赋予个人完全的控制权与自由度,去构建一个真正属于自己的、能够与全球网络共振的节点。无论你是开发者、设计师、作家还是任何领域的爱好者,深入理解并掌握你的网站源代码,便是握紧了开启数字世界无限可能性的钥匙。现在,是时候审视或开始编写你的那份独一无二的数字蓝图了。
以上是关于web个人网站设计源代码 web个人网站设计源代码是什么的介绍,希望对想了解建站百科知识的朋友们有所帮助。
本文标题:web个人网站设计源代码 web个人网站设计源代码是什么;本文链接:https://zwz66.cn/jianz/245525.html。
Copyright © 2002-2027 小虎建站知识网 版权所有 网站备案号: 苏ICP备18016903号-19
苏公网安备32031202000909